Bearings limited rcb081214 needle bearing drawn cup roller clutch & bearing assembly bore 12.7mm needle roller bearings are a type of roller bearings and are classified as either radial or thrust depending on the direction of the load they support. Needle roller bearings include bearings whose rollers slightly exceed the size range of needle rollers as stipulated by iso. Needle roller bearings include drawn cup solid radial bearings and thrust needle bearings. Needle roller bearings are available in two types caged and full complement. Drawn cup outer rings are made of carefully selected alloy steel sheet. They are surface-hardened alter precise pressing giving them a unique structure. The cage of the needle bearing accurately guides the rollers at the pitch diameter of the rollers. The surface of the cage is hardened to reduce frictional torque and increase rigidity and wear resistance.
